Julian from Yamaha comes in to show Lee the amazing new THR amps from Yamaha.
The Yamaha THR10C is all about those classic boutique bluesy sounding amps. Every aspect of the amp has been designed with this in mind, digital Delay is replaced a warm Tape Delay Emulation and each of the effects are tuned to the sound of the old classic amps.
THR10C takes the personal-amp concept to a new level of audio fidelity. The finest tube amps respond to a player's every touch -- with picking dynamics and playing style adding as much to the tone as your guitar and pickups.

You have to go to the audio interface setup and enable all 4 input channels of the amp's audio interface. You have THR Left & Right channels and THR DI Left & Right channels. Then, it's just a matter of choosing the right source for each track. Sounds like you're recording the DI channel at the moment. Hope that helps.

One minor detail about the Tap Tempo .
The tap tempo also sets phaser . After settling up Waylon Jennings style very slow phaser , it sets the same tempo for the tape echo .
And until rewatching this , I just assumed the Tape Echo feature was for crap , and just not any good .
So I guess I'll have to expend one preset just for Waylon , then re tap to get functional delay .
